diff --git a/src/fitnesse/responders/WikiImportingTraverser.java b/src/fitnesse/responders/WikiImportingTraverser.java index 82de46011b..ce89651ebd 100644 --- a/src/fitnesse/responders/WikiImportingTraverser.java +++ b/src/fitnesse/responders/WikiImportingTraverser.java @@ -89,9 +89,9 @@ public void pageImportError(WikiPage localPage, Exception e) { } public static class ImportError { - private String message; - private String type; - private Exception exception; + private final String message; + private final String type; + private final Exception exception; public ImportError(String type, String message) { this(type, message, null); diff --git a/src/fitnesse/slim/SlimException.java b/src/fitnesse/slim/SlimException.java index aacbc96e6a..c9f2fa10cc 100644 --- a/src/fitnesse/slim/SlimException.java +++ b/src/fitnesse/slim/SlimException.java @@ -3,16 +3,16 @@ public class SlimException extends Exception { private static final String PRETTY_PRINT_TAG_START = "message:<<"; private static final String PRETTY_PRINT_TAG_END = ">>"; - private String tag; - private boolean prettyPrint; + + private final String tag; + private final boolean prettyPrint; public SlimException(String message) { - this(message, false); + this(message, "", false); } public SlimException(String message, boolean prettyPrint) { - super(message); - this.prettyPrint = prettyPrint; + this(message, "", prettyPrint); } public SlimException(String message, String tag) { @@ -26,12 +26,11 @@ public SlimException(String message, String tag, boolean prettyPrint) { } public SlimException(Throwable cause) { - this(cause, false); + this(cause, "", false); } public SlimException(Throwable cause, boolean prettyPrint) { - super(cause); - this.prettyPrint = prettyPrint; + this(cause, "", prettyPrint); } public SlimException(Throwable cause, String tag) { @@ -49,8 +48,7 @@ public SlimException(String message, Throwable cause) { } public SlimException(String message, Throwable cause, boolean prettyPrint) { - super(message, cause); - this.prettyPrint = prettyPrint; + this(message, cause, "", prettyPrint); } public SlimException(String message, Throwable cause, String tag) {